Drainage pump installation services involve setting up specialized equipment designed to move excess water away from properties. These systems are typically installed in areas prone to flooding, water accumulation, or poor drainage, helping to prevent water damage and maintain a dry, stable environment. The process includes assessing the property’s drainage needs, selecting the appropriate pump type, and installing the unit securely to ensure reliable operation. Skilled service providers can handle everything from initial site evaluation to final setup, ensuring the system functions effectively when needed.

This service helps resolve common drainage issues such as basement flooding, yard water pooling, and soggy landscaping. Poor drainage can lead to structural damage, mold growth, and compromised foundations, especially during heavy rains or rapid snowmelt. Installing a drainage pump provides a practical solution by actively removing water from problem areas, reducing the risk of water-related damage and the associated repair costs. Local contractors can recommend the right type of pump-such as sump pumps, effluent pumps, or sewage pumps-based on the specific challenges of each property.

Properties that typically benefit from drainage pump installation include residential homes, especially those with basements or crawl spaces that are susceptible to flooding. Commercial buildings, such as warehouses or retail spaces located in flood-prone zones, often require drainage solutions to protect inventory and infrastructure. Additionally, properties with poorly graded landscapes, inadequate gutters, or underground water issues may need professional installation of drainage pumps to address persistent water accumulation. The overview below groups typical Drainage Pump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or drainage pump repairs or replacements gener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the specific issue and parts needed.

Standard Installation - The cost to install a new drainage pump in a standard setting usually falls between $1,000 and $3,000. Larger or more complex setups can push costs higher, but most projects are completed within this range.

Full System Replacement - Replacing an entire drainage system or upgrading to a high-capacity pump can cost $3,500 to $7,000 or more. These larger projects are less common but are necessary for extensive or outdated systems.

Complex or Custom Projects - Custom drainage solutions or projects involving difficult access can range from $5,000 to $15,000+. Such jobs are less frequent and typically involve specialized equipment or extensive site work.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When evaluating potential service providers for drainage pump installation, it’s helpful to consider their experience with similar projects. Homeowners should inquire about how many installations they have completed that resemble the scope and complexity of the work needed. A contractor with a proven track record in handling drainage systems comparable to the current project can offer insights into potential challenges and solutions, helping ensure the chosen professional is well-equipped to deliver satisfactory results.

Clear written expectations are also crucial when comparing local contractors. Homeowners should seek detailed descriptions of the services offered, including the scope of work, materials to be used, and any specific steps involved in the installation process. Having this information in writing helps prevent misunderstandings and ensures everyone is aligned on what will be delivered, making it easier to evaluate proposals and select a provider who meets the project’s needs.

Reputable references and good communication practices are key indicators of a reliable service provider. Homeowners are encouraged to ask for references from previous clients who had similar drainage pump installations, and to follow up with those references to learn about their experiences. Additionally, a professional who communicates clearly, responds promptly to questions, and provides transparent information throughout the process can help foster confidence and ensure the project proceeds smoothly. These qualities contribute to a positive working relationship and a successful installation.

What types of drainage pumps do local contractors install? Local service providers typically install various types of drainage pumps, including sump pumps, sewage pumps, and effluent pumps, depending on the specific drainage needs of a property.

How do I know if a drainage pump is needed for my property? A professional assessment by local contractors can determine if a drainage pump is necessary to prevent flooding, manage water flow, or improve drainage in your area.

Are drainage pump installations suitable for both residential and commercial properties? Yes, drainage pump installation services are available for both residential and commercial properties, tailored to the scale and requirements of each site.

What factors influence the choice of a drainage pump for installation? Factors such as the volume of water to be managed, the property's drainage system, and the location of water sources help determine the appropriate type and size of a drainage pump.

How do local contractors ensure proper drainage pump installation? Experienced service providers follow best practices for installation, including correct placement, secure connections, and ensuring the pump operates efficiently within the existing drainage system.
